Blue Dragon Series Awards Planned To Be Held For The First Time In 2022, Where Famous Names In The World Of Korean Drama And Variety Shows Will Be Honored.


Good news comes for fans of Jisoo. The reason is that recently the BLACK PINK girl group member was announced as a nominee for "Best New Actress" at the Blue Dragon Series Awards 2022, thanks to her spectacular acting as the female lead Eun Youngro from the drama "Snowdrop".


Besides Jisoo, the drama "Snowdrop" itself was also nominated for the Best Drama Award at the same event. The Blue Dragon Series Awards is scheduled to be held for the first time in 2022, where famous names in the Korean drama and variety show world will be honored.


The awards ceremony will also be the first in Korea to have a category for an OTT series. The online voting for the “Blue Dragon Series Awards” will be announced in the near future, while the awards ceremony will be held on July 19, 2022, at the Incheon Paradise Hotel.


Meanwhile, the drama “Snowdrop”, which was released in December 2021, is Jisoo's first time taking on a lead role, after several cameos in “The Producers” and “Arthdal ​​Chronicles”. In the series, this idol actress has provided an excellent portrayal of the female lead Eun Youngro, and conveyed various emotions, from growing love, hatred, to despair.


Meanwhile, “Snowdrop”, which stars various well-known actors including Jisoo, Jung Hae In, Kim Min Kyu, Yoo In Na and Kim Hye Yoon, was previously involved in controversy due to alleged “historical distortion”, but it aired smoothly. The series went on to receive great acclaim from the public and critics alike. (wk/aiss)
